Why Electrical Literacy Matters for Homeowners

You don't need an electrician's license to be a safer, more informed homeowner. What you do need is a working knowledge of how your home's electrical system is organized, what its warning signals look like, and — critically — where your involvement should stop.

Electrical issues are among the leading causes of residential house fires in the United States. Most hazardous situations don't begin with dramatic sparks; they start quietly: a loose connection behind a wall plate, a circuit quietly running hotter than it should, an outlet that was wired incorrectly years ago. Recognizing the early signs gives you time to act before a small problem becomes a dangerous one.

This guide won't teach you to rewire a room. Instead, it gives you the vocabulary, the warning checklist, and the clear boundary between what's safe to handle and what belongs in the hands of a licensed professional. Key Electrical Terms Explained Simply

Electrical conversations between homeowners and electricians often stall because of unfamiliar terminology. These definitions will help you understand what you're looking at and what you're being told.

Circuit breaker

A resettable safety switch in your electrical panel that automatically shuts off power to a circuit when too much current flows through it, preventing overheating or fire.

GFCI outlet

A Ground Fault Circuit Interrupter outlet detects tiny current imbalances and cuts power in milliseconds to prevent electric shock. Required by code in wet areas like kitchens, bathrooms, and outdoors.

Arc fault

An unintended electrical discharge that jumps across a gap in damaged or loose wiring. Arc faults generate intense heat and are a leading cause of home electrical fires.

Circuit load

The total amount of electrical power being drawn by all devices on a single circuit at one time. Exceeding a circuit's rated load causes the breaker to trip.

Amperage (amps)

The measure of electrical current flowing through a wire. Household circuits are typically rated at 15 or 20 amps; exceeding that rating is what causes a breaker to trip.

Grounding

A safety pathway that directs excess electrical current safely into the earth, reducing the risk of shock if a fault occurs inside a device or outlet.

Warning Signs You Should Never Ignore

Most electrical problems announce themselves before they become emergencies. Train yourself to notice the following:

  • Burning or fishy smell near outlets or the panel: Overheating insulation or components produce a distinctive odor. Do not dismiss this.
  • Discolored or warm outlet and switch plates: Heat escaping through a faceplate indicates a problem inside the wall.
  • Breakers that trip repeatedly: A breaker is doing its job by tripping, but frequent trips on the same circuit suggest the circuit is consistently overloaded or has a fault.
  • Flickering or dimming lights: Occasional flicker during appliance startup is usually minor. Persistent or widespread flickering suggests a loose connection or panel issue.
  • Buzzing or crackling sounds from outlets: Audible electrical noise is never normal and often signals arcing — a fire risk.
  • Outlets with scorch marks: Even minor discoloration around an outlet face is a sign of past arcing or heat damage.

Never Ignore Electrical Smells

A burning, acrid, or fishy odor near an outlet, switch, or panel is a serious warning sign that should never be attributed to dust or dismissed as minor. These smells can indicate insulation melting or active arcing inside your walls. Turn off the relevant circuit immediately and do not use it until a licensed electrician has inspected it.

If you notice any combination of these signs — especially smell plus heat plus flickering — treat it as urgent. Turn off the affected circuit at the breaker and contact a licensed electrician before using it again.

What You Can Safely Do Yourself

There is a meaningful set of electrical tasks that most homeowners can handle safely, without touching wiring or opening the panel:

  1. Reset a tripped breaker: Flip the breaker fully off, then back on. If it trips again, stop and call a professional.
  2. Test and reset GFCI outlets: Press 'Test,' confirm power cuts out, then press 'Reset.' Do this monthly in kitchens, bathrooms, garages, and outdoor areas.
  3. Replace a like-for-like outlet or switch cover plate: Swapping a damaged plastic faceplate — not the outlet itself — requires no electrical contact.
  4. Change a lightbulb or swap a plug-in lamp: Standard tasks that carry no wiring risk when the fixture is off.
  5. Use a non-contact voltage tester: This inexpensive tool lets you confirm a circuit is de-energized before touching anything. It does not require wiring knowledge to use safely.

Keep a Simple Electrical Log

Write down every time a breaker trips, an outlet stops working, or you notice flickering — including the date and which room or circuit is affected. This record helps an electrician diagnose patterns quickly and reduces diagnostic time (and cost) during a service call.

When You Must Call a Licensed Electrician

The following tasks are outside safe DIY territory for virtually all homeowners, regardless of general handiness:

  • Any work inside the main electrical panel or subpanel
  • Adding a new circuit or outlet
  • Replacing or upgrading the panel itself
  • Installing a hard-wired appliance (range, dryer, EV charger, whole-house generator)
  • Troubleshooting aluminum wiring, knob-and-tube wiring, or any pre-1970s system
  • Rewiring or splicing wires inside walls

Most of these tasks also require permits and inspections under local building codes. Work done without permits can complicate home sales, void insurance claims, and leave hazards hidden inside your walls. Always verify requirements with your local building or permitting department before any project begins.

Calling a professional is not an admission of incompetence — it's the practical and safe choice. A licensed electrician carries the training, tools, and liability insurance to do the work correctly and legally. Your role is to recognize the problem early and describe it clearly, which is exactly what this guide has prepared you to do.
